Saqib Karim is the current MD of Ezi Floor at Victoria. Prior to this, they were the Assistant VP of Global Deployment at Afiniti.com from September 2017 to April 2018. There, they were responsible for providing leadership for multidisciplinary teams for diverse and complex enterprise projects, as well as life-cycle management of existing deployments to deliver customer value.
From January 2008 to April 2017, Karim was the Regional Head for Emerging Software & Solutions at Avaya. In this role, they were responsible for managing the software development process and developing new software products.
Prior to their work at Avaya, Karim was the Director / Program Manager at P1 Consulting Pte Ltd from February 2007 to September 2007, and the Owner / Program Manager of P1 Consulting Services from August 2003 to February 2004.
Saqib Karim has an MBA from The Ohio State University, an M. Sc from Iowa State University, and a B.Eng from Ahmadu Bello University.
Their manager is Philippe Hamers, CEO. They work with Jan Debrouwere - MD, Victoria Carpets UK, Phil Smith - MD, Victoria Carpets Australia, and José Luis Lanuza Quilez - MD, Victoria Ceramics Spain.

Victoria PLC is a designer, manufacturer and distributor of flooring products. The Company's principal activities are the manufacture, distribution and sale of floorcoverings. Its segments include UK and Australia. It manufactures wool and synthetic broadloom carpets, carpet tiles, underlay and flooring accessories. In addition, it markets and distributes a range of luxury vinyl tile (LVT) and hardwood flooring products produced by third-party manufacturers. Its product offering in the United Kingdom ranges from both crafted, woven Wilton carpets to Tufted carpets in a myriad of fashion colors and styles. Its stock range offerings cover saxonies, tonals, velvets, twists and natural loop pile styles for residential use. The Company supplies its products to the mid to high end residential market and contract sector both in the United Kingdom and overseas. Its subsidiary, Munster Carpets Limited, is engaged in the manufacture and distribution of floorcoverings for the contract market.
